Blackridge Fleet Center is seeking a skilled and motivated Fleet Maintenance & Service Repair Technician to join our team. This position plays a critical role in maintaining and repairing commercial fleet vehicles and specialty equipment while demonstrating our core values of respect, integrity, growth, humility, and teamwork.

If you enjoy working on medium-duty trucks, hydraulic systems, lift gates, cranes, and specialty fleet equipment — and take pride in delivering precise, high-quality work — we want to meet you.

What You’ll Bring
  • 3+ years of fleet, medium/heavy-duty truck, or commercial equipment repair experience preferred
  • Self‑managed, self‑starter and problem solver
  • Experience with cab & fleet repair, service bodies, and vocational truck systems
  • Working knowledge of hydraulic systems, lift gates, cranes, hoists, and PTO systems
  • Familiarity with electrical diagnostics, wiring, and auxiliary equipment installation
  • Basic welding and fabrication skills preferred
  • Ability to read and interpret schematics, repair manuals, and service bulletins
  • Strong diagnostic and troubleshooting skills
  • Ability to safely operate shop equipment and power tools
  • Ability to lift and move up to 50 lbs
  • Valid driver’s license with acceptable driving record
  • Must be 18 years or older and authorized to work in the U.S.
  • High School Diploma or equivalent
What You’ll Be Doing
  • Perform maintenance and repairs on fleet vehicles including cab & chassis trucks and specialty upfit equipment
  • Diagnose and repair hydraulic systems, lift gates, cranes, hoists, and related components
  • Inspect, troubleshoot, and repair electrical systems including lighting, control modules, PTO wiring, and auxiliary systems
  • Conduct preventative maintenance services on commercial fleet vehicles
  • Complete multi‑point inspections and document findings accurately
  • Communicate repair needs and timelines clearly with service advisors and supervisors
  • Ensure all repairs meet company, state, federal, and manufacturer safety standards
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ment
  • Assist with installation and service of truck‑mounted equipment as needed
  • Support team members and help train less experienced technicians when appropriate
